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Milliken Park to Rawcliffe start from as little as £31.20

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Milliken Park to Rawcliffe start from £72.60 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Milliken Park to Rawcliffe are available for £95.30 one way

Facilities and Amenities

While Milliken Park may lack the extensive facilities of a bustling city hub, it caters efficiently to its passengers' fundamental needs. Although there's no ticket office on site, the station is equipped with ticket machines that support online ticket collection, ensuring a hassle-free start to your journey. Accessibility isn't overlooked, as step-free access and induction loops are available, making the station user-friendly for everyone. However, do note there are no toilets, refreshments, or shops available, so plan accordingly. If you need help, customer information is available via departure screens and announcements, because there are no staff to assist in person.

Transport Connections

Getting to and from Milliken Park is conveniently supplemented by various transport links. Local buses are accessible from Cochranemill Road, and taxis can be arranged via TrainTaxi. For those unexpected moments when train services are disrupted, rail replacement buses ensure your travels are never too far off track. Comprehensive information on local bus services can be retrieved from Traveline Scotland, providing all the necessary details for a stress-free off-train experience.

Station Facilities at Rawcliffe

First things first, Rawcliffe train station is an unstaffed station, which means there are no ticket offices or machines available for purchasing or collecting tickets onsite. This may come across as a limitation for some, but not to worry. Purchasing tickets online is a simple process and ensures you’re well-prepared before arriving at the station. Be sure to make full use of online ticket-buying platforms which offer easy purchasing and collection options elsewhere. Despite the lack of facilities, the station itself provides step-free access and induction loops, making it accessible to all passengers, including those with mobility challenges. There is a presence of CCTV within the bicycle storage area, adding a layer of security for cyclists.

Onward Travel Options

Once you've arrived at Rawcliffe station, connecting to your final destination is made easy through several transport links available nearby. Although the station doesn't offer direct access to taxis or car hire services, there's a handy taxi link service online available that can bring a cab to you. For those opting for bus services, there’s a bus stop conveniently located close to the station. For any unexpected rail disruptions, the rail replacement service is accessible adjacent to the level crossing, ensuring your journey remains uninterrupted.
